Thank you to our library volunteers, without your help our library would not be opened to students the entire school day as well as before and after school! ![]() We Have eBooks!I’m pleased and excited to announce that our school library now provides access to hundreds of eBooks. Our ebooks do not require an iPad, a Kindle reader or any special device – they are designed to be viewed on an internet-connected computer. Hundreds of ebooks are available 24/7 at school, at home, or anywhere you have internet access. There is no limit on the number of students viewing/reading an individual title at the same time. Our ebook library offers constant access for everyone! The ebooks provide students, parents and teachers with a combination of printed text, narration, words, sounds, music, graphics, photos and animation. Many ebooks also include links to quizzes, activities and reviews. No passwords are required. Many titles are AR titles. Most of the ebooks are designed to appeal to K-5 students, but titles in the TumbleReadables collection include titles suitable for students K through 12. Take some time to explore the choices to see what might be appropriate for your child. You will find links to our ebooks on the Laguna Library Webpage. Look for the ebooks link in the Library Catalog section. Take a look at our school’s ebooks today to see the tremendous variety of titles available now for your children.
